Days to Treasure by Agnes Bellegris

On September 11th, Owl’s Nest is pleased to be hosting local author Agnes Bellegris for a signing of her book Days to Treasure.  Agnes will be available for chats, questions and autographs from 2 to 4pm. 

About the Book:
Days to Treasure is a nostalgic interpretation of the joys of childhood play throughout the four seasons.  Written in sublte poetic form with thoughtfully rendered illustrations by Katerina Meritkas, this keepake book will engage people of all ages. 

About the Author:
Agnes Bellegris is professional writer and editor based out of Calgary.  She has an avid interest in children’s literacy and learning, providing author visits and workshops to schools in Calgary and beyond.

Just confirmed: Madelaine Wong to read from Cradling the Past…

Cradling the Past: A Biography of Margaret Shaw by Madelaine Wong and Margaret Shaw (paperback, $18.90)

On April 17th at 2:00pm Madelaine Wong, co-author of Cradling the Past: The Life of Margaret Shaw will join us at the Owl’s Nest for a reading and signing.   

Ms. Wong, along with her mother Margaret Shaw, has created a book that is a wonderful record of a life in Alberta.  Margaret Shaw grew up in the Great Depression, attended a convent school where she struggled for acceptance, and was a teacher in a one-room-schoolhouse during the Second World War.  She raised ten children, two of them diagnosed with autism. 

It’s stories like Margaret Shaw’s that are too often forgotten, but they are the stories that have shaped Alberta into what it is today. 

Madelaine Wong will be reading from Cradling the Past at 2:00pm on Saturday, the 17th of April.   The reading will be followed by a quick question period, then a signing.
